Unit addresses should be written using lower-case hex characters. Use
wifi_mac@c to fix a yaml schema validation error once the eFuse
dt-bindings have been converted to a yaml schema:
efuse: Unevaluated properties are not allowed ('wifi_mac@C' was
unexpected)
Also node names should use hyphens instead of underscores as the latter
can also cause warnings.

Linux kernel
============
There are several guides for kernel developers and users. These guides can
be rendered in a number of formats, like HTML and PDF. Please read
Documentation/admin-guide/README.rst first.
In order to build the documentation, use ``make htmldocs`` or
``make pdfdocs``. The formatted documentation can also be read online at:
https://www.kernel.org/doc/html/latest/
There are various text files in the Documentation/ subdirectory,
several of them using the Restructured Text markup notation.
Please read the Documentation/process/changes.rst file, as it contains the
requirements for building and running the kernel, and information about
the problems which may result by upgrading your kernel.
